某型舰炮采集记录检测系统设计 被引量:3

Design of the Signal Data Acquisition and Detection System of a Naval Gun
下载PDF
导出
摘要 根据某型舰炮结构特征和控制信号特点,设计开发出便携有效的信号采集盒,使用CAN总线结构收集、传输和实时监测舰炮各运行参数。以LABWINDOWS为软件开发平台开发检测和故障诊断系统,利用数据库中的专家系统,操作者可以轻松完成部件级的故障判断,系统给出维修保障建议。经实验验证,该系统具有便携、使用方便、性能可靠和扩展性强的特点。 Abstract: A potable and effective data acquisition and detection system is designed according to the configuration characteristics and working principle of a naval gun. In the subordinate computer part, the portable data acquisition box is designed with CAN communication system. In the upper monitor part, a fault diagnosis system is developed with LABWINDOWS/CVI, which is a kind of programming language. The works such as data sampling, displaying, saving and fault diagnose can be finished conveniently and in time with the Expert system in the database. This system is been used in practical engineering with good effect.
